How they compare
OECD members currently reports 2.75 Mt CO2e against 0.2947 Mt CO2e in Trinidad and Tobago, a difference of 2.46 Mt CO2e.
That makes OECD members's figure about 9.3 times Trinidad and Tobago's.
Across all 55 years both countries report, OECD members has been ahead every year.
OECD members ranks 12th and Trinidad and Tobago ranks 9th of 44 groups.
OECD members has averaged higher in every one of the 6 decades both report.

About this data
A measure of annual emissions of methane (CH4), one of the six Kyoto greenhouse gases (GHG), from industrial processes including IPCC 2006 codes 2.A.1 Cement production, 2.A.2 Lime production, 2.A.3 Glass Production, 2.A.4 Other Process Uses of Carbonates, 2.B Chemical Industry, 2.C Metal Industry, 2.D Non-Energy Products from Fuels and Solvent Use, 2.E Electronics Industry, 2.F Product Uses as Substitutes for Ozone Depleting Substances, 2.G Other Product Manufacture and Use and 5.A Indirect N2O emissions from the atmospheric deposition of nitrogen in NOx and NH3. The measure is standardized to carbon dioxide equivalent values using the Global Warming Potential (GWP) factors of IPCC's 5th Assessment Report (AR5).
